org.eclipse.emf.codegen.ecore.gwt
Class GWTBuilder

java.lang.Object
  extended by org.eclipse.core.internal.events.InternalBuilder
      extended by org.eclipse.core.resources.IncrementalProjectBuilder
          extended by org.eclipse.emf.codegen.ecore.gwt.GWTBuilder
All Implemented Interfaces:
IExecutableExtension

public class GWTBuilder
extends IncrementalProjectBuilder


Field Summary
protected static IPath[] CONTAINER_PATHS
           
 
Fields inherited from class org.eclipse.core.resources.IncrementalProjectBuilder
AUTO_BUILD, CLEAN_BUILD, FULL_BUILD, INCREMENTAL_BUILD
 
Constructor Summary
GWTBuilder()
           
 
Method Summary
protected  IProject[] build(int kind, java.util.Map args, IProgressMonitor monitor)
           
protected  void clean(IProgressMonitor monitor)
           
protected  void copy(URI sourceURI, URI targetURI)
           
 
Methods inherited from class org.eclipse.core.resources.IncrementalProjectBuilder
forgetLastBuiltState, getBuildConfig, getCommand, getContext, getDelta, getProject, getRule, getRule, hasBeenBuilt, isInterrupted, needRebuild, rememberLastBuiltState, setInitializationData, startupOnInitialize
 
Methods inherited from class java.lang.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
 

Field Detail

CONTAINER_PATHS

protected static IPath[] CONTAINER_PATHS
Constructor Detail

GWTBuilder

public GWTBuilder()
Method Detail

build

protected IProject[] build(int kind,
                           java.util.Map args,
                           IProgressMonitor monitor)
                    throws CoreException
Specified by:
build in class IncrementalProjectBuilder
Throws:
CoreException

copy

protected void copy(URI sourceURI,
                    URI targetURI)

clean

protected void clean(IProgressMonitor monitor)
              throws CoreException
Overrides:
clean in class IncrementalProjectBuilder
Throws:
CoreException

Copyright 2001-2012 IBM Corporation and others.
All Rights Reserved.